Blood Betrayal and Badges: The Ultimate Chinese Drama Guide

Blood Betrayal and Badges explores how sworn brothers in a Chinese drama navigate loyalty when palace politics and hidden agendas collide. The series uses historical uniforms and rank badges to visualize shifts in trust, turning each embroidered insignia into a signal of alliance or deception.

As factions scheme for power, characters hide behind ritual and ceremony, revealing how easily comrades become suspects. The drama shows that in a court where every accessory can be a weapon, even a badge of office may mark a target instead of protection.

Hidden Betrayal Behind The Uniform

Within the ornate armor and embroidered robes, secret meetings take place in moonlit courtyards. Blood Betrayal and Badges frames each uniform change as a turning point where allies cross lines they once swore to defend.

Costume design becomes narrative language, as color coded insignia mark which characters can be trusted and which are deep cover agents. The drama suggests that in a court stitched with lies, a badge may look grand yet signal vulnerability instead of authority.

Brotherhood Tested By Court Intrigue

Childhood friends take opposing sides when edicts demand loyalty to the throne over personal bonds. Subtle gestures, shared glances, and withheld confessions reveal how trust erodes long before accusations are spoken aloud.

The script emphasizes that blood ties and sworn oaths collide when survival instincts override sentimental memories, turning reunion scenes into tense negotiations masked by formal ceremony.

Symbolism Of Rank Badges In Story

Each embroidered creature on the chest communicates status, responsibility, and hidden allegiances. When a badge is stripped or exchanged, the drama signals a narrative rupture that alters how other characters speak and behave.

Producers use historically accurate replicas in key confrontations, allowing viewers to read power shifts at a glance. The recurring motif of raising or lowering a sleeve to reveal or hide a badge turns costume into a quiet but potent form of dialogue.

Political Maneuvering And Moral Ambiguity

Characters justify betrayals by claiming they serve a greater stability, blurring the line between villain and tragic anti hero. The drama questions whether a system that rewards deception can ever reward true loyalty.

Viewers witness alliances shift like weather, with former enemies joining forces and trusted advisors suddenly falling from grace. This mirrors real bureaucratic environments where survival often depends on reading between the lines of formal protocol.
